Structure and Composition
The Stainless Steel Engineering Plastic Chain is composed of high-quality stainless steel and engineering plastic materials. The stainless steel provides strength and corrosion resistance, while the engineering plastic offers flexibility and wear resistance. This combination results in a chain that can withstand demanding environments and maintain its performance over time.

Maintenance and Care
To ensure optimal performance and longevity of the Stainless Steel Engineering Plastic Chain, it is important to follow proper maintenance and care practices. Here are some recommendations:
- Clean the chain regularly using a mild detergent and water. Avoid using harsh chemicals that can damage the materials.
- Inspect the chain for any signs of wear or damage. Replace any worn-out or damaged sections promptly.
- Apply a suitable lubricant to the chain to reduce friction and prevent corrosion. Consult the chain manufacturer for recommended lubricants.
